| /** |
| * Unit tests for {@link com.android.osu.NetworkConnection}. |
| */ |
| @SmallTest |
| public class NetworkConnectionTest { |
| private static final String TEST_SSID = "TEST SSID"; |
| private static final String TEST_SSID_WITH_QUOTES = "\"" + TEST_SSID + "\""; |
| private static final int TEST_NETWORK_ID = 1; |
| |
| @Mock Context mContext; |
| @Mock Handler mHandler; |
| @Mock WifiManager mWifiManager; |
| @Mock NetworkConnection.Callbacks mCallbacks; |
| |
| @Before |
| public void setUp() throws Exception { |
| initMocks(this); |
| when(mContext.getSystemService(Context.WIFI_SERVICE)).thenReturn(mWifiManager); |
| } |
| |
| /** |
| * Verify that an IOException will be thrown when failed to add the network. |
| * |
| * @throws Exception |
| */ |
| @Test(expected = IOException.class) |
| public void networkAddFailed() throws Exception { |
| when(mWifiManager.addNetwork(any(WifiConfiguration.class))).thenReturn(-1); |
| new NetworkConnection(mContext, mHandler, WifiSsid.createFromAsciiEncoded(TEST_SSID), |
| null, mCallbacks); |
| } |
| |
| /** |
| * Verify that an IOException will be thrown when failed to enable the network. |
| * |
| * @throws Exception |
| */ |
| @Test(expected = IOException.class) |
| public void networkEnableFailed() throws Exception { |
| when(mWifiManager.addNetwork(any(WifiConfiguration.class))).thenReturn(TEST_NETWORK_ID); |
| when(mWifiManager.enableNetwork(eq(TEST_NETWORK_ID), eq(true))).thenReturn(false); |
| new NetworkConnection(mContext, mHandler, WifiSsid.createFromAsciiEncoded(TEST_SSID), |
| null, mCallbacks); |
| } |
| |
| /** |
| * Verify that the connection is established after receiving a |
| * WifiManager.NETWORK_STATE_CHANGED_ACTION intent indicating that we are connected. |
| * |
| * @throws Exception |
| */ |
| @Test |
| public void openNetworkConnectionEstablished() throws Exception { |
| when(mWifiManager.addNetwork(any(WifiConfiguration.class))).thenReturn(TEST_NETWORK_ID); |
| when(mWifiManager.enableNetwork(eq(TEST_NETWORK_ID), eq(true))).thenReturn(true); |
| NetworkConnection connection = new NetworkConnection(mContext, mHandler, |
| WifiSsid.createFromAsciiEncoded(TEST_SSID), null, mCallbacks); |
| |
| // Verify the WifiConfiguration being added. |
| ArgumentCaptor<WifiConfiguration> wifiConfig = |
| ArgumentCaptor.forClass(WifiConfiguration.class); |
| verify(mWifiManager).addNetwork(wifiConfig.capture()); |
| assertEquals(wifiConfig.getValue().SSID, TEST_SSID_WITH_QUOTES); |
| |
| // Capture the BroadcastReceiver. |
| ArgumentCaptor<BroadcastReceiver> receiver = |
| ArgumentCaptor.forClass(BroadcastReceiver.class); |
| verify(mContext).registerReceiver(receiver.capture(), any(), any(), any()); |
| |
| // Setup intent. |
| Intent intent = new Intent(WifiManager.NETWORK_STATE_CHANGED_ACTION); |
| NetworkInfo networkInfo = new NetworkInfo(ConnectivityManager.TYPE_WIFI, 0, "WIFI", ""); |
| networkInfo.setDetailedState(NetworkInfo.DetailedState.CONNECTED, "", ""); |
| intent.putExtra(WifiManager.EXTRA_NETWORK_INFO, networkInfo); |
| WifiInfo wifiInfo = new WifiInfo(); |
| wifiInfo.setNetworkId(TEST_NETWORK_ID); |
| intent.putExtra(WifiManager.EXTRA_WIFI_INFO, wifiInfo); |
| |
| // Send intent to the receiver. |
| Network network = new Network(0); |
| when(mWifiManager.getCurrentNetwork()).thenReturn(network); |
| receiver.getValue().onReceive(mContext, intent); |
| |
| // Verify we are connected. |
| verify(mCallbacks).onConnected(eq(network)); |
| } |
| } |
